Types of Cat Flaps
There are several kinds of cat flaps available on the marketplace, including:
- Manual Cat Flap: A manual cat flap is the a lot of fundamental kind of cat flap and needs your cat to press through a flap to go into or leave your house.
- Automatic Cat Flap: An automated cat flap uses a sensor to discover your cat's presence and opens and closes immediately.
- Microchip Cat Flap: A microchip cat flap uses a microchip placed into your cat's skin to detect their existence and open the flap.
- Magnetic Cat Flap: A magnetic cat flap uses a magnet to detect your cat's presence and open the flap.

Step-by-Step Installation Process
Setting up a cat flap is a fairly straightforward process that can be completed in a couple of hours. Here is a detailed guide:
- Choose the place: Choose a place for the cat flap that is safe and hassle-free for your cat flap installation service providers. Preferably, this ought to be a door or wall that leads directly outdoors.
- Measure the location: Measure the location where you prepare to set up the cat flap to make sure that it fits comfortably.
- Mark the area: Use a pencil and marker to mark the area where you prepare to set up the cat flap.
- Cut the hole: Use a saw or jigsaw to cut a hole in the door or wall that is a little bigger than the cat flap.
- Install the cat flap: Place the cat flap in the hole and protect it with screws or nails.
- Add weatherproofing products: If desired, include weatherproofing materials such as caulk or weatherstripping to prevent air leaks and moisture from going into the home.
- Check the cat flap: Test the cat flap to ensure that it is working properly and that your cat entrance installers can go into and leave your home safely.

Regularly Asked Questions
Here are a few frequently asked questions about cat flaps and their installation:
Q: What is the very best type of cat flap for my cat?A: The best kind of cat flap for your cat flap fitters will depend upon their specific needs and preferences. Consider elements such as size, ease of use, and security when choosing a cat flap.
Q: How do I install a cat flap in a brick wall?A: Installing a cat flap in a brick wall can be more difficult than installing one in a door or wood wall. You might require to use a specialized drill bit and anchor to protect the cat flap in location.
Q: Can I set up a cat flap myself?A: Yes, installing a cat flap installers flap is a fairly simple process that can be completed by a DIY lover. Nevertheless, if you are not comfy with tools or are uncertain about the installation process, it may be best to work with a professional.
Q: How much does a cat flap cost?A: The cost of a cat flap can vary depending on the type and quality of the product. Usually, a basic cat flap can cost between ₤ 20 and ₤ 50, while an advanced design can cost upwards of ₤ 100.
